Abstract

Animating articulated 3D meshes via text requires satisfying strict kinematic constraints, modeling causal interactions between parts, and achieving instruction fidelity. Due to a scarcity of training data, existing data-driven mesh animation methods are largely inapplicable. To address this, we propose ArtiMo, a novel agent-driven framework for text-guided articulated mesh animation. Operating in a zero-shot manner, ArtiMo employs an autonomous agent powered by Large Language and Vision-Language Models to orchestrate motion generation. By synergizing the explicit kinematic constraints of URDF with the agent's reasoning and planning capabilities, it effectively produces causally coherent part motions and interactions without requiring model fine-tuning. To ensure high-fidelity results, the agent additionally utilizes a visual self-improvement mechanism: generated animations are rendered into compact keyframes and motion cues, enabling the VLM to iteratively diagnose and correct errors. Furthermore, we contribute a new benchmark dataset spanning 21 object categories with high-quality motion annotations. Extensive experiments demonstrate that ArtiMo significantly outperforms existing baselines, particularly on complex, causally-driven motions.

Method

ArtiMo combines structured articulated assets, visual-language diagnosis, and executable motion planning in a closed loop.

ArtiMo method overview
Overview of our agent-driven articulated mesh animation framework. Given a URDF asset and an action prompt, our system performs link analysis, causal motion planning, and critic--actor refinement to generate a causally correct 4D articulated animation.
